Did i use my smart guns wrong?
When I aim from a smart weapon, more than half of my bullets for some reason don’t even come close to hitting my opponents, what is the reason for this? I didn't understand some mechanics?

Blackpine Oct 1, 2023 @ 11:48am 
Smart guns need some time to acquire target. Once red square on your enemy goes small - you can start shooting.
Though you need to equip appropriate cybernetics. Also ping quickhack and recon grenades shorten the homing time for smart guns too.

TripSin Oct 1, 2023 @ 12:17pm 
1. You need a the cyberware in the Hands catgeory that will let you use smart weapons
2. You have to have the enemy in the smart weapon window range for a certain amount of time before it locks on to the enemy

Originally posted by Nekropl:
3. I didn’t upgrade the smart weapons branch because... I didn’t see any skills there that significantly improve accuracy, is it really possible that without this, a smart weapon is 90% useless?

They exist. Specifcally, one gives +2% accuracy per max RAM, which... can be a lot, like I've currently got ~29 or so max RAM w/ and not all the relevant cyberware is T5, and it's also with a -4 penalty factored in because one of my cyberware implants does that in exchange for a boosted critical hit chance with quickhacks. So, in this case, +58% accuracy for a perk that requires Int 9 and three points to reach/have it (acquisition specialist + precision subroutines).
